Flow cytometric profile of CD134 expression on non-stimulated peripheral blood lymphocytes. Human peripheral blood lymphocytes were stained with either PE Mouse Anti-Human CD134 (Cat. No. 555838, solid line histogram) or PE Mouse IgG1, κ Isotype Control (Cat. No. 555749, dashed line histogram). The fluorescence histograms depicting CD134 (or Ig isotype control) expression were derived from gated events with the side and light-scatter characteristics of viable lymphocytes. Flow cytometry was performed on a BD FACScan™.
PE Mouse Anti-Human CD134
Flow cytometric profile of CD134 expression on PHA-stimulated peripheral blood lymphocytes. Human peripheral blood lymphocytes were stimulated with PHA and incubated with recombinant OX40 ligand (R&D Systems, Cat. No. 1054-ox), then stained with either PE Mouse Anti-Human CD134 (Cat. No. 555838, solid line histogram) or PE Mouse IgG1, κ Isotype Control (Cat. No. 555749, dashed line histogram). The fluorescence histograms depicting CD134 (or Ig isotype control) expression were derived from gated events with the side and light-scatter characteristics of viable lymphocytes. Flow cytometry was performed on a BD FACScan™.

Preparation And Storage

Store undiluted at 4°C and protected from prolonged exposure to light. Do not freeze. The monoclonal antibody was purified from tissue culture supernatant or ascites by affinity chromatography. The antibody was conjugated with R-PE under optimum conditions, and unconjugated antibody and free PE were removed.

Antibody Details
Down Arrow Up Arrow
ACT35

The ACT35 monoclonal antibody specifically binds to CD134 which is also known as OX40. The 35 kDa CD134 polypeptide is encoded by the TNFRSF4 gene. CD134 is a type I integral membrane glycoprotein and member of the tumor necrosis factor/nerve growth factor receptor (TNFR/NGFR) family. CD134 is expressed on activated T lymphocytes, hematopoietic precursor cells and fibroblasts. CD134 functions as a T cell costimulatory receptor when bound by OX40 Ligand/TNFSF4 that is expressed by antigen presenting cells. CD134 thereby plays roles in T-cell activation as well as the regulation of differentiation, proliferation or apoptosis of normal and malignant lymphoid cells. Analysis of the nucleotide sequence of the human TNFRSF4 cDNA reveals strong homology with the rat Tnfrsf4 cDNA sequence. OX40 was clustered as CD134 in the Sixth International Workshop on Human Leukocyte Differentiation Antigens.

Format Details
Down Arrow Up Arrow
PE
R-Phycoerythrin (PE), is part of the BD family of Phycobiliprotein dyes. This fluorochrome is a multimeric fluorescent phycobiliprotein with excitation maximum (Ex Max) of 496 nm and 566 nm and an emission maximum (Em Max) at 576 nm. PE is designed to be excited by the Blue (488 nm), Green (532 nm) and Yellow-Green (561 nm) lasers and detected using an optical filter centered near 575 nm (e.g., a 575/26-nm bandpass filter). As PE is excited by multiple lasers, this can result in cross-laser excitation and fluorescence spillover on instruments with various combinations of Blue, Green, and Yellow-Green lasers. Please ensure that your instrument’s configurations (lasers and optical filters) are appropriate for this dye.
